前言

现在大部分App底部都有一个菜单,实现这个功能也有好多办法:

- TabHost+Fragment
- RadioGroup+Fragment
- FragmentTabHost+Fragment
- 5.0以后有个新控件,BottomNavigator

这篇主要介绍下FragmentTabHost配合Fragment使用

FragmentTabHost 布局问题

官方在给出例子的时候,并没有贴出对应的布局文件,这个布局文件有一些要求,所以我就把我自己写的贴出来吧,方便大家观看


<?xml version="1.0" encoding="utf-8"?>
<LinearLayout
xmlns:android="http://schemas.android.com/apk/res/android"
xmlns:app="http://schemas.android.com/apk/res-auto"
xmlns:tools="http://schemas.android.com/tools"
android:layout_width="match_parent"
android:layout_height="match_parent"
android:orientation="vertical"
tools:context="com.study.buttomtabdemo.MainActivity">
<FrameLayout
 android:id="@+id/flayout_content"
 android:layout_width="match_parent"
 android:layout_height="0dp"
 android:layout_weight="1"/>
<com.study.buttomtabdemo.widget.FragmentTabHost
 android:id="@android:id/tabhost"
 android:layout_width="match_parent"
 android:layout_height="wrap_content"
 android:background="#ffffff">
 <FrameLayout
  android:id="@android:id/tabcontent"
  android:layout_width="0dp"
  android:layout_height="0dp"
  android:layout_weight="0"/>
</com.study.buttomtabdemo.widget.FragmentTabHost>
</LinearLayout>

这里要注意以下几点:

1.我自己自定义了一个FragmentTabHost,因为原来的FragmentTabHost每次切换Fragment事都会走一遍onCreateView()和onResume()方法;

2.id必须是android:id=”@android:id/tabhost”这个;

3.里面的FrameLayout的id必须是android:id=”@android:id/tabcontent”

FragmentTabHost 使用

下面就到了具体使用的过程了

1.定义Tab类

因为它属于Tab的一个组合吧,里面包含好多个Tab,所以我们先定义一个Tab类


/**
* 主页TAB对应实体
* Created by HFS on 2017/5/7.
*/
public class Tab {
private int title; // 文字
private int icon; // 图标
private Class fragment; // 对应fragment
public Tab(Class fragment,int title, int icon ) {
 this.title = title;
 this.icon = icon;
 this.fragment = fragment;
}
public int getTitle() {
 return title;
}
public void setTitle(int title) {
 this.title = title;
}
public int getIcon() {
 return icon;
}
public void setIcon(int icon) {
 this.icon = icon;
}
public Class getFragment() {
 return fragment;
}
public void setFragment(Class fragment) {
 this.fragment = fragment;
}
}

这里面要对应相应的Fragment,所以需要一个Fragment对象

2.初始化Tab集合

有几个Tab就往Tab集合添加几个Tab   


Tab tab_home = new Tab(HomeFragment.class,R.string.home,R.drawable.selector_icon_home);
 Tab tab_hot = new Tab(HotFragment.class,R.string.hot,R.drawable.selector_icon_hot);
 Tab tab_category = new   Tab(CategoryFragment.class,R.string.catagory,R.drawable.selector_icon_category);
 Tab tab_cart = new Tab(CartFragment.class,R.string.cart,R.drawable.selector_icon_cart);
 Tab tab_mine = new Tab(MineFragment.class,R.string.mine,R.drawable.selector_icon_mine);
 mTabs.add(tab_home);
 mTabs.add(tab_hot);
 mTabs.add(tab_category);
 mTabs.add(tab_cart);
 mTabs.add(tab_mine);

3.setUp

找到该控件之后,就要调用对应的这个方法


mInflater = LayoutInflater.from(this);
 mTabhost = (FragmentTabHost) this.findViewById(android.R.id.tabhost);
 mTabhost.setup(this,getSupportFragmentManager(),R.id.flayout_content);

4.添加TabSpec

到这一步就要添加TabSpec了,有几个Tab,就添加几个TabSpec        


for (Tab tab : mTabs){
  TabHost.TabSpec tabSpec = mTabhost.newTabSpec(getString(tab.getTitle()));
  tabSpec.setIndicator(buildIndicator(tab));
  mTabhost.addTab(tabSpec,tab.getFragment(),null);
 }
 //构建Indicator
 private View buildIndicator(Tab tab){
  View view =mInflater.inflate(R.layout.tab_indicator,null);
  ImageView img = (ImageView) view.findViewById(R.id.icon_tab);
  TextView text = (TextView) view.findViewById(R.id.txt_indicator);
  img.setBackgroundResource(tab.getIcon());
  text.setText(tab.getTitle());
 return view;
}

5.设置默认显示第一个


mTabhost.setCurrentTab(0);

6.设置没有分割线


mTabhost.getTabWidget().setShowDividers(LinearLayout.SHOW_DIVIDER_NONE);
